What does an entry level real estate consultant do?

An Entry Level Real Estate Consultant assists clients in buying, selling, or renting properties while learning the fundamentals of the real estate industry. They work under the supervision of more experienced agents, helping with tasks such as property showings, preparing documents, conducting market research, and supporting marketing efforts. This role is a stepping stone for those new to the field, providing essential training and experience required for future advancement as a licensed real estate agent.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level real estate consultant,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Real Estate Consultant, you need a basic understanding of real estate principles, strong sales aptitude, and often a real estate license depending on your region. Familiarity with CRM software, property listing platforms, and digital marketing tools is typically required. Exceptional communication, negotiation, and customer service skills help build client trust and close deals. These capabilities are crucial for effectively matching clients with properties, managing transactions, and succeeding in a competitive marketplace.

What types of support and training can entry level real estate consultants typically expect from their brokerage?

Entry-level real estate consultants often receive comprehensive support from their brokerage, including onboarding programs, mentorship from experienced agents, and access to training sessions on sales techniques, market analysis, and legal regulations. Many brokerages provide resources such as marketing materials, lead generation tools, and customer relationship management (CRM) platforms to help new consultants build their client base. Regular team meetings and shadowing opportunities also foster collaboration and skill development. This supportive environment is designed to help new consultants transition smoothly into the industry and develop the confidence needed to succeed.

How do I become an entry level real estate consultant?

To become an entry-level real estate consultant, you typically need a high school diploma or equivalent, complete any required real estate licensing courses, and pass the licensing exam. Developing strong communication, sales, and customer service skills is also important, along with gaining knowledge of local real estate markets and tools like Multiple Listing Service (MLS).
